Types of Refinance Loans Offered
At Summit Lending, we provide a variety of refinance loan options tailored for residents in the 78061 Zip Code of Texas. Refinancing can help you adjust your current mortgage to better suit your financial needs. Below, we outline the key types available through our services.
Rate-and-Term Refinancing: This option allows you to change the interest rate or the term of your existing loan without taking out additional cash. For example, you might switch from a higher rate to a lower one or extend your loan term for lower monthly payments. Cash-Out Refinancing: If you have built up equity in your home, this type of refinance lets you borrow against that equity to access cash for purposes like home improvements, debt consolidation, or other expenses. Remember, Texas has specific requirements for cash-out refinances, so we recommend checking our resources or using our Loan Calculator to estimate potential outcomes.
Other Standard Options: We also offer streamline refinancing programs, which are designed to simplify the process with reduced documentation. These are often available for specific loan types like FHA or VA loans, making it easier for eligible borrowers. Eligibility and Requirements for Refinance Loans
To qualify for refinance loans in the 78061 Zip Code, Texas, certain general criteria must be met. These requirements help ensure that borrowers are in a strong financial position to secure better terms on their existing mortgage.
Credit Score Considerations
A key factor in refinancing eligibility is your credit score. Typically, a minimum credit score of 620 is required for conventional loans. Higher scores can lead to better interest rates and more favorable terms. Debt-to-Income Ratio Factors
Your debt-to-income (DTI) ratio is another critical element, with a cap generally at 43%. This ratio compares your monthly debt payments to your gross monthly income. Property and Appraisal Requirements
For properties in 78061, refinancing often requires at least 20% equity in your home, meaning the loan cannot exceed 80% of the property's value. An appraisal is typically needed to verify this equity and the property's current market value. Ensure your property qualifies as a primary residence, as this is a common requirement. Local Insights for 78061, Texas
In the 78061 zip code of Texas, several regional factors can influence your decision to refinance a mortgage. Texas has seen steady housing market trends, with a median home sales price around $354,375 and homes typically staying on the market for about 54 days. These trends suggest a competitive environment where refinancing could help you secure better terms if interest rates drop, potentially saving you money on monthly payments.
State-specific regulations in Texas play a crucial role in refinancing. For instance, you generally need at least 20% equity in your home for a cash-out refinance, with loans capped at 80% loan-to-value (LTV). There are also waiting periods, such as 6 months after purchase or 12 months between refinances, and requirements like a minimum credit score of 620 and a debt-to-income ratio not exceeding 43%.
